I am thinking of starting a site about British comedies in the near future. Which of these domains do you think would be more appropriate for it, and why?

BritishComedy.com
Comedies.co.uk

BritishComedy.com is better, because (here in America, at least) the phrase British comedy refers to a specific genre of comedy. Its not merely comedy that was created in the United Kingdom, it's comedy with its own unique quirks and traits. Comedies.co.uk conveys the fact that its a UK domain, but doesnt say anything about the specific type of comedy offered there.
